Reduced GTA Home Sales and Drop in Property Listings in August 2026 may Renew Price Growth The number of homes available for sale in August 2026 was down noticeably compared to last year in the Greater Toronto Area (GTA). Following this trend, home sales also edged lower, as the number of transactions was arguably limited by less choice in some neighbourhoods. Less choice and more competition between buyers could ultimately result in renewed price growth in the months ahead. GTA... [read more]

GTA Housing Market Provides More Choice and Greater Affordability for Buyers As Real Estate Prices Drop by 7.2% in October 2025 Home sales in the Greater Toronto Area (GTA) were down year-over-year in October, while new listings were up. Market conditions continued to favour homebuyers, as average selling prices were negotiated down alongside lower mortgage rates. “Buyers who are confident in their employment situation and ability to make their mortgage payments over the long...
